The Corbie Collection
The Corbie Collection is a series of atmospheric digital artworks by Alba Noir, featuring ravens woven into the cityscapes, landmarks and historic places of Scotland.
Known in Scots as a corbie, the raven appears throughout the collection as a watcher, companion and recurring symbol. It may be found perched above a familiar skyline, resting on a monument, circling an ancient ruin or quietly observing the streets below.
Each piece reimagines a recognisable Scottish location through a darker, more mysterious lens, combining local character, gothic atmosphere and contemporary digital art. From Glasgow landmarks and industrial skylines to old kirks, castles, coastlines and mist-covered landscapes, the collection celebrates Scotland as a place of beauty, history and shadow.
